The Bosch Rexroth Indramat DDS02.1-A050-D is a Digital AC Servo Drive Controller and is part of the DDS Drive Controllers series. It has a rated current of 50 Amps and uses digital servo feedback for motor feedback. The drive features IP20 protection, operates at temperatures from 0 to 45 degrees Celsius, and is cooled by air from outside the control cabinet.

Product Description:
The DDS02.1-A050-D is a digital AC servo drive controller developed by Bosch Rexroth Indramat for the DDS Drive Controllers series. In an automated cell, it converts DC-bus energy from a supply module into regulated three-phase power and sends speed and torque commands to a paired servomotor. The closed-loop design lets motion commands from a higher-level PLC be executed with fine resolution, which supports repeatable positioning on indexing tables, packaging axes, and similar equipment. This arrangement helps the drive respond quickly to changing loads while keeping axis motion stable during normal machine cycles.
The controller supplies up to 50 A of continuous output current, which is the maximum steady-state motor load the internal power stage can sustain without derating. Its housing has an IP20 enclosure rating, so it blocks solid objects larger than 12 mm and is intended for installation inside a cabinet. Heat is removed by external air cooling; airflow taken from outside the enclosure passes directly over the heat sink and helps manage temperature when several drives share one rack. Position and velocity are monitored through digital servo feedback, allowing the control electronics to adjust switching patterns and maintain commanded setpoints during load changes. Safe operation is permitted within a 0 to 45 °C operating range, and the controller reaches its stated electrical performance only when that temperature window is maintained.
Site planning must respect a 1000 m maximum installation elevation, because higher altitudes reduce cooling effectiveness and may require current reduction. During transport or warehouse storage, the electronics tolerate a −30 to 85 °C storage range without damage to capacitors or protective coatings. The unit is part of Line 02 and is built as Version 1, which indicates the revision level used for this model. These identifiers help place the controller within the DDS product line and match it to the correct mechanical layout and control configuration.
